Factor VIII deficiency treatment market size & share
According to Technavio’s analyst, the global factor VIII deficiency treatment market is anticipated to grow at a steady rate and post a CAGR of close to 6% during the forecast period. The increasing adoption rate of prophylactic drugs will drive the growth prospects for the global factor VIII deficiency treatment market until the end of 2021.

Factor VIII deficiency treatment market status based on geography
In terms of geography, the Americas accounted for the majority market share during 2016 and will continue to dominate the factor 8 deficiency treatment market for the next four years. Some of the major factors responsible for the market’s growth in the region is the growing number of new product launches and increasing amount of investment in manufacturing and production facilities by various vendors.
Factor VIII deficiency treatment market worth: Competitive landscape and key vendors
The global factor VIII deficiency treatment market is highly competitive and diversified due to the presence of a large number of regional and international vendors across the globe. It has been observed that these vendors in the factor 8 deficiency treatment market are increasingly competing against each other based on factors such as aggressive pricing, novel products such as extended half-life therapies, gene therapy products, and prophylactic drugs.

Factor VIII deficiency treatment market segmentation by type of disease application
- Hemophilia A drugs
- Hemophilia A inhibitors treatment
- Von Willebrand disease treatment
The global hemophilia A drugs market segment accounted for the majority market share during 2016 and will continue to dominate the factor 8 deficiency treatment market for the next four years. Some of the major factors responsible for the market segment's growth is the growing incidence of hemophilia A, the development of novel drugs with extended action, and the increased adoption of prophylactic treatment. Additionally, growing demand for novel recombinant extended half-life products, the emergence of monoclonal antibodies and gene therapy products, and launch of plasma-derived products for recombinant factor VIII at low costs, will also further drive the growth of the factor VIII deficiency treatment market.
Factor VIII deficiency treatment market segmentation by type of disease management
- Prophylaxis
- On-demand
- Inhibitor
The prophylaxis segment accounted for the majority market share during 2016 and will continue to dominate the factor 8 deficiency treatment market during the forecasted period. One of the major factors responsible for the market segment's growth is the cost-effectiveness of prophylactic treatment in comparison to on-demand treatment.
